Anyone have any A6 transmission problems?
 
This morning on my way to work, I noticed a weird semi jolt feeling around 1800 rpm while cruising from a stop. Did it all morning for 25 miles. I was driving hard lastnight with the paddles. I'm just over 20k miles in my 13 Z

silversleeper 07-18-2018 01:24 PM

As it shifts from first to second gear? As the torque converter locks?
IDK if going to manual shift mode or paddle operation defeats torque converter lockup but I'd try to eliminate low fluid as a possibility, or normal gear changes, or normal torque converter lockup before I jumped to a bad trans conclusion.

C-redfly 07-18-2018 02:14 PM

Yeah it feels like when it locks up, it gives jolting. Weather in manual mode or drive mode, same feeling.

silversleeper 07-18-2018 02:31 PM

If it were me I would treat it as this type problem:
https://www.camaro6.com/forums/showthread.php?t=510888


With proper flush and fill of the OEM proper fluid. If that didn't make it go away either change the torque converter or take it to a very smart person to be fixed. I wouldn't trust any lube/chain shops to do the flush, I'd have the dealer do it or DIY.
